The Catholic Diocese of Cleveland was founded on April 23, 1847. It is the twenty-third
largest diocese in the United States. The Most Reverend Edward C. Malesic was
installed as the 12th Bishop of Cleveland on September 14, 2020. The diocese
encompasses the counties of Cuyahoga, Summit, Lorain, Lake, Geauga, Medina, Wayne
and Ashland. There are more than 670,000 Catholics in the Diocese, and Catholic
Charities- Diocese of Cleveland is one of the largest diocesan systems of social services
in the world. There are 185 parishes, 107 Catholic schools, 1 pastoral center and 1
mission office within the diocese. The cathedral is the Cathedral of St. John the
Evangelist, located in downtown Cleveland. Members of the diocesan staff support the
Bishop in ministering to the people of God by working together to provide vision,
leadership and service to continue the mission of Jesus to transform the world. As a
community, they are committed to live by the values of faith, dignity, stewardship and
justice.
